#d7c6d2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d7c6d2 is composed of 84.3% red, 77.6%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 7.9% magenta, 2.3% yellow and 15.7% black. It has a hue angle of 317.6 degrees, a saturation of 17.5% and a lightness of 81%. #d7c6d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#af8da5.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#d7c6d2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d7c6d2 has RGB values of R:215, G:198,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.08, Y:0.02,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14141138.
